Type
ORACLE
Validation date
2024-02-21 04:50: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03823,
    "usd": 0.04136
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001EA353D57F16C16149DAB7AD32F38FDF8A1DF817E4A85366CF23689F9A849D233

Previous signature

4F1F58D5D0BB46EB2E90EBD88C73AA07DF00379A6E6839DDE655EE3AAF916FD4AD8C83E5256DE232011F870A425C5728957F6835B2083EEF6B5D6C3CF058D80E

Origin signature

3044022070D50826E88FE048D91BDE013B35C789EF90CF7312C7E8EF9632974C5865FE6E02206902415E7DB8E5B2D26AF73383D1E2C041FF5381713D0B7C9D7E0D041D602176

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00AAB334DA67E5C199E1EB59C5D027BEE29B4DA85950D8E85676EE6782AA07F326

Coordinator signature

0768F4455E29C8FF6D3CA9429D2425EF6A3F2F7404C7F7BFDA4AA5F7B3A408B86F662192F48909D6AA4439372DEDD195B6FF498D562FDFEAE5C24E53BF131307

Validator #1 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#1 signature

4A990492B19001EE1E2FB273A548DF88BA98E9D3731E19EBAF07267D42D6BC86B6A8E8D2F66E29D8474E5B985000375EA9E32488DE1E5BE02F97F6AE4758FA01

Validator #2 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#2 signature

CD6FAB86AAED63B0DE9BF79E0901465AB60061B5799E5A8B7870240259FC735A9966E64596A06A633B9B69B3EE3E086C6CC8EBC414BB0E015620863B6180280D